Explore on map
Close map
Free Delivery
4.217
75 Hazellville Rd, London, ,N19 3NB
Free Delivery
Off
3.915
8 Grove RoadMile End, LondonE3 5AX
Free Delivery
3.02
75 Hazellville Road,London, .N19 3NB
Free Delivery
5.01
1023 Finchly RoadLondon, LondonNW11 7ES
Free Delivery
3.818
105 Bear Road, Hanworth,, FelthamTW13 6SA
Free Delivery
5.01
29 South Road,Southall,, LondonUB1 1SU
Free Delivery
5.01
458 A Bromley RoadBromley, BromleyBR1 4PP
Free Delivery
5.01
373A Archway RoadLondon, LondonN6 4EJ
Free Delivery
3.510
193 East lane, Wembley,, LondonHA0 3NG
Free Delivery
5.019
55 Salisbury Road,Hounslow,, LondonTW4 7NW
Free Delivery
4.120
100 Sudbury Avenue, North WembleyBrent,, LondonHA0 3BG
Free Delivery
5.01
493 Bromley Rd, Bromley, ,BR1 4PQ
Free Delivery
5.01
499 Bromley Rd, Bromley, ,BR1 4PQ
Free Delivery
5.01
114 Baconsfield RoadLondon, LondonUB1 1DR
Free Delivery
4.313
6, Queens parade, Queens Road,, LondonNW4 3NS
Free Delivery
5.08
94 Trafalgar Road,Greenwich, LondonSE10 9UW
Free Delivery
5.01
79 Lassell StreetLondon, LondonSE10 9PJ
Free Delivery
2.35
230 Uxbridge RoadFeltham, ,TW13 5DL
Free Delivery
5.01
18 Bow Triangle Business CentreLondon, ,E1 7TP
Free Delivery
5.01
18 Bow Triangle Business CentreLondon, ,E3 4UR
Free Delivery
5.01
45, River Gardens Walk, London, LondonSE10 0UB